About to Reinstal Vista


nvr2fst
 Share

Recommended Posts

I am putting a new processor in tomorrow. So I figured it would be a good time for a clean instal of Vista. I am worried about my savegames after reading how many have lost theirs. Dont want to lose mine because I am around 60 percent through. I have read the posts but I see so many different peoples method and then others saying it didnt work for them.

 

 

Is there one worth a sticky? I have played only offline. Another question, is it better to use a clean hard drive just for games only and have the OS on another. I have plenty of drives I could use.

ARGJÄVLAKUND

Hey.

 

I went from XP Pro to Windows Vista Ultimate and saved my gamefiles on an USB-stick with no problems.

 

Here's how I did it.

 

1. Backup the LATEST (most recent save date) saved game in \AppData\Local\Rockstar Games\GTA IV\savegames

 

2. Install Vista and GTA IV.

 

3. Start a new game and go to Roman's apartment and save a game.

 

4. Turn the game off and enable 'See hidden files and folders'

 

5. Locate the new Rockstar Games folder in C:\Users\YOURNAMEHERE\AppData\Local\Rockstar Games\GTA IV\savegames

 

6. Replace the saved game in the \savegames\ folder with the one you backed up.

 

7. Go into GTA IV and play your saved game!

 

 

This was my Games for Windows - Live online profile account. No 3rd party creepy software needed.

 

Hope this helps.

well im using WinXP and my saved game was in c:\Documents & Settings\USERNAME\Local Settings\Application Data\Rockstar Games\GTAIV\Savegames

in that savegames folder is another folder with an ID number attached to it, im not sure where in Vista your Rockstar Games folder will be but once you find it back the entire directory up somewhere safe

after you have reinstalled Vista and reinstalled the game go to same location and put the files that are in the folder with the ID number into the new ID folder created after you reinstalled game and your saved games will show up in game, i did this and it worked a treat

IMPORTANT YOU MUST PUT THE FILES IN THE NEW ID FOLDER CREATED AND NOT JUST PUT THE OLDER FOLDER BACK IN IF YOU DO YOUR SAVE GAMES WONT SHOW IN THE GAME!!

Its different for Vista. Your saves are located at C:\Users\(username)\AppData\Local\Rockstar Games\GTA IV\savegames.

 

The COD4 saves are located here at C:\Program Files\Activision\Call of Duty 4 - Modern Warfare\players\profiles\(Your profile name).

 

And WaW saves are located at C:\Users\(username)\AppData\Local\Activision\CoDWaW.
